The Role of Workover Rigs in Expanding Well Life Expectancy
Oil and gas wells are substantial financial investments, frequently representing countless dollars in exploration, boring, and completion prices. Nevertheless, like any mechanical system, wells encounter deterioration over time. Workover gears play a critical role in expanding the life expectancy of these wells, allowing drivers to get one of the most value from their properties. By addressing operational issues, enhancing productivity, and maintaining equipment, workover rigs ensure that wells continue to function optimally for decades.

The Aging of Oil Wells: Common Problems

Over time, oil and gas wells can experience a decline in manufacturing as a result of numerous aspects, consisting of:

Tank Exhaustion: The natural decrease in reservoir pressure leads to reduced circulation prices.
Mechanical Failures: Issues such as tubing leaks, equipment deterioration, and pump failings can trigger a well to stop producing.
Wellbore Blockages: Debris, sand, and various other products can collect inside the well, obstructing the flow of oil or gas.
Water Access: Water from bordering formations can infiltrate the wellbore, reducing the well's result.
These concerns, if left unaddressed, can drastically decrease the lifespan of a well and lead to substantial monetary losses. This is where workover rigs enter into play.

Just How Workover Rigs Address Well Aging

Workover rigs are important for conducting well treatments that deal with these common concerns, consequently extending the life of the well. Some of the main ways workover rigs aid enhance well longevity consist of:

Repairing Mechanical Failings Among the main uses workover rigs is to fix mechanical issues within the well. With time, elements such as tubing, covering, or pumps can wear or damage down. A workover rig can be deployed to remove and change defective parts, making certain that the well can remain to operate efficiently.

Tubes Replacement: When tubing inside the well corrodes or ends up being blocked, it can dramatically decrease oil or gas circulation. Workover rigs permit the removal and substitute of tubes, bring back the well's performance.

Downhole Pump Repair Works: If the pump that aids lift oil to the surface comes to be damaged, a workover gear is used to obtain and change it, avoiding long term downtime.

Cleaning the Wellbore Gradually, wells can become blocked with particles, sand, or even paraffin wax, restricting the circulation of oil or gas. A workover gear can be utilized to clean these clogs using specialized devices such as coiled tubes or wireline equipment. This wellbore cleansing procedure removes obstructions and permits the well to generate at its full capacity.

Sand Monitoring: In some wells, sand manufacturing can be a chronic problem. Workover gears can be made use Click here of to install sand control systems that protect against the migration of sand into the wellbore, protecting its durability.

Well Excitement Decreasing well efficiency is frequently because of lowered pressure or tank deficiency. Workover gears are used to stimulate wells, enhancing their outcome and prolonging their functional life. Strategies such as hydraulic fracturing or acidizing can open up brand-new networks in the storage tank, allowing oil or gas to flow more freely.

Hydraulic Fracturing (Fracking): By injecting high-pressure fluid into the well, fractures are produced in the rock formations surrounding the wellbore. This enables caught oil and gas to stream more quickly, renewing the well's performance.

Acidizing: Acid is pumped right into the well to liquify rock and particles, cleansing the wellbore and increasing circulation rates. This approach is typically used in carbonate developments and can significantly improve production.

Connecting and Abandonment In instances where components of a well are no longer effective, a workover rig can be used to isolate these areas. This entails connecting the depleted areas while allowing other components of the well to proceed creating. By tactically plugging and deserting areas of the well, operators can expand the efficient life of the staying sections.

The Long-Term Benefits of Making Use Of Workover Gears

The long-lasting benefits of using workover rigs to expand well life are considerable. First, they prevent the demand for pricey new drilling procedures. The expense of drilling a brand-new well much exceeds the cost of using a workover rig to repair an existing one. By maintaining and fixing wells, firms can avoid the high capital expenditure related to brand-new drilling jobs.

Second, workover gears lower downtime. A malfunctioning well can result in substantial lost profits, yet quick interventions utilizing workover gears can bring wells back on-line promptly. This helps to maintain production levels and prevent disturbances to oilfield procedures.

Finally, extending the life of a well with workover treatments likewise reduces the ecological effect of exploration. By obtaining even more worth from existing wells, the requirement for additional exploration (which has greater ecological repercussions) is minimized.
